Two crises. One solution.

Coliving converts a traditional single-family home into a shared living community. Each bedroom is rented individually at an affordable price point, $750 to $950 per room, while the total property revenue jumps dramatically.

Residents share common areas like kitchens, living rooms, and outdoor spaces. They get affordable housing with built-in community. Owners get 2 to 3 times the revenue of a traditional rental.

The housing crisis

76%

of Americans say housing affordability is a growing crisis. Median rent now exceeds 30% of median income in most metros, and traditional rental models can't serve the 44 million Americans who are cost-burdened. Our rooms rent for $750 to $950: 20 to 30% below market apartments.

The loneliness epidemic

58%

of U.S. adults report feeling lonely. The Surgeon General declared it a public health crisis with health impacts equivalent to smoking 15 cigarettes a day; isolation costs employers $154B a year in lost productivity. Our houses ship with community built in, and residents stay an average of two years.
